
By Barbara Barbieri McGrath, Martha Alexander (Illustrator)
A witch struggles to bake a pie with unhelpful monster friends.
A little green witch faces a daunting task: crafting a pumpkin pie without any help from her lazy monster friends. Ghosts, bats, and gremlins refuse to lend a hand, leaving her to tackle the challenge alone. Will she succeed in her spooky endeavor, or will her monstrous companions learn a lesson in teamwork? This Halloween tale offers a whimsical twist on a classic story, filled with magical mischief and unexpected surprises.
The little green witch has a problem: her lazy monster friends just won’t help her make a horrible pumpkin pie. Not ghost, nor bat, nor gremlin. Barbara McGrath’s feisty retelling of “The Little Red Hen,” with Martha Alexander’s charming illustrations, is the perfect choice for Halloween fun.
